Hey all,

I've got an MSI K7D Master-L and a Promise ATA133 Controller Card.

Right now I have the following hooked up to the card:
IDE 1 --> Maxtor 80gb 7200 + Maxtor 40gb 7200
IDE 2 --> Liteon 40x12048x + HP 200i DVD+RW Burner

Motherboard:
IDE1 --> None / None
IDE2 --> None / None

Seeing as how I've got nothing on the motherboard right now, could I? Could I run up to 8 IDE devices?
 
yup, you should be able to run up to 8 devices with no problem. i have never used a pci ide controller, but i think that the primary channel master drive will automatically be the boot drive, if i am not mistaken... there might be a way that you can boot from a drive on the card instead of the primary master on your mobo, but yes you can run 8 drives total.

You can boot off the add in card. I have done it no problems.

does it show up in your bios where you can select a drive or what? or is it a seperate bios on the add in card? just curious for future reference.
 
Yea, you can boot off the card (look above - all my devices are on the card)

After normal BIOS, the card has its own BIOS where it detects drives, then boots into windows.
